Concerned about recent damaging oil spills, Senator Gaylord Nelson from Wisconsin worked with volunteers to organize teach ins on college campuses across the country to raise awareness about air and water pollution. Climate Change WebJan 31, 2024 · Earth Day roughly coincides with U.S. Arbor Day, so see if your community is holding a tree-planting event and join up. If physically planting a tree is unrealistic for you, there are other options! Try donating to a reputable environmental non-profit that will plant trees on your behalf instead.
